Ver Mensaje Individual
  #3 (permalink)  
Antiguo 06/07/2014, 11:53
GeriReshef
 
Fecha de Ingreso: julio-2012
Ubicación: Israel
Mensajes: 360
Antigüedad: 11 años, 9 meses
Puntos: 40
Respuesta: Optimizar o disminuir el tiempo de ejecución de un update

Cocuerdo con lo que que iislas ha escrito.
Yo añadiria otro filtro-
Where M.FechaMovimiento = I.Fecha_Proceso
para evitar inecesarias actualizaciones, especialmente si intentas la recomendación de iislas sobre el Set RowCount.
Otros factores que influyen el rendimiento de esta instrucción:
1. M.FechaMovimiento es parte del Clustered Index?
2. La tabla Movimientos tiene triggers?
3. Cuantas filas hay en Movimientos ?
4. Verifica que la clausula On (del Join) es correcta y no crea productos cartesianos.
__________________
El Castellano no es mi lengua materna: discúlpenme por los errores gramaticales.
Mi blog